Background
- Scope and content:
-
The collection contains a one-page statement of subsistence purchased, impressed, and received in tax in kind in the 4th district of Virginia by A. W. Harris, a captain in the Confederate Army during the American Civil War. The food (including bacon, wheat, corn, and beef) are dated to be purchased between March 25, 1864, to June 30, 1864, in Russell, Washington, and Scott counties.
- Biographical / historical:
-
The statement was made by Captain A. W. Harris of the Confederate Army during the American Civil War. He was located in the 4th district of Virignia in Russell, Washington, and Scott counties in 1864. There is no further information on Capt. A. W. Harris.
